Ir al contenido

Cloudflare AI Gateway

Cloudflare AI Gateway se sitúa delante de las API del proveedor y le permite añadir análisis, almacenamiento en caché y controles. Para Anthropic, OpenClaw utiliza la API de Anthropic Messages a través de su endpoint de Gateway.

PropiedadValor
Proveedorcloudflare-ai-gateway
URL basehttps://gateway.ai.cloudflare.com/v1/<account_id>/<gateway_id>/anthropic
Modelo predeterminadocloudflare-ai-gateway/claude-sonnet-4-6
Clave de APICLOUDFLARE_AI_GATEWAY_API_KEY (su clave de API del proveedor para las solicitudes a través del Gateway)

Cuando el pensamiento está habilitado para los modelos de Anthropic Messages, OpenClaw elimina los turnos de relleno previo del asistente finales antes de enviar la carga a través de Cloudflare AI Gateway. Anthropic rechaza el relleno previo de respuestas con pensamiento extendido, mientras que el relleno previo ordinario sin pensamiento sigue estando disponible.

  1. Establecer la clave de API del proveedor y los detalles de Gateway

    Ejecute la incorporación y elija la opción de autenticación de Cloudflare AI Gateway:

    Ventana de terminal
    openclaw onboard --auth-choice cloudflare-ai-gateway-api-key

    Esto solicita su ID de cuenta, ID de gateway y clave de API.

  2. Establecer un modelo predeterminado

    Añada el modelo a su configuración de OpenClaw:

    {
    agents: {
    defaults: {
    model: { primary: "cloudflare-ai-gateway/claude-sonnet-4-6" },
    },
    },
    }
  3. Verificar que el modelo esté disponible

    Ventana de terminal
    openclaw models list --provider cloudflare-ai-gateway

Para configuraciones con scripts o CI, pase todos los valores en la línea de comandos:

Ventana de terminal
openclaw onboard --non-interactive \
--mode local \
--auth-choice cloudflare-ai-gateway-api-key \
--cloudflare-ai-gateway-account-id "your-account-id" \
--cloudflare-ai-gateway-gateway-id "your-gateway-id" \
--cloudflare-ai-gateway-api-key "$CLOUDFLARE_AI_GATEWAY_API_KEY"
Gateways autenticados

Si habilitó la autenticación de Gateway en Cloudflare, agregue el encabezado cf-aig-authorization. Esto es además de su clave de API del proveedor.

{
models: {
providers: {
"cloudflare-ai-gateway": {
headers: {
"cf-aig-authorization": "Bearer

”, }, }, }, }, } ```

Nota sobre el entorno

Si el Gateway se ejecuta como un demonio (launchd/systemd), asegúrese de que CLOUDFLARE_AI_GATEWAY_API_KEY esté disponible para ese proceso.

Selección de modelo

Cómo elegir proveedores, referencias de modelos y el comportamiento de conmutación por error.

Solución de problemas

Solución de problemas generales y preguntas frecuentes.